Antoine Tavaglione - Toronto Show & New Prints!

Posted on May 22, '13 by Station 16.


Antoine Tavaglione is a growing name in the pop-art scene. He recently finished a campaign with 'Ford' (which is currently up at Berri Metro in Montreal, see pics below), and now has a solo show up in Toronto until the end of June (open weekends and weekdays by appointment, 431 Roncesvalles Ave). Station 16 created 12 new prints with Antoine for his Toronto debut, and now we're happy to announce the release of two of these prints for our online site!


Launching today is the "TAVA Skull", a 4-colour 14 edition, silkscreen print with sugar dust (on heavy Crane's Lettra 100% cotton paper). As well as 3 colour-combo "Double C's" Print, in WHITE, PINK and BLACK backgrounds (also on Crane's Lettra paper).

New Stikki Peaches Print & MassivArt Chromatic!

Posted on May 10, '13 by Station 16.


We're excited to present a new print by MTL street artist Stikki Peaches. The new print is titled 'Popeye-Balboa' and is a very limited edition of 16, this 8 colour print is signed, numbered and measures 20x26 inches. Now Avaliable HERE
